Dr. Rance Thomas has been inducted into the International Educator’s Hall of Fame. Thomas achieved a master’s in sociology from SIUE in 1973 and was a lecturer of sociology and criminal justice from January 2005 through May 2006. He was a 2009 inductee of the SIUE Hall of Fame.

Southern Illinois University Edwardsville is the fastest growing public institution in Illinois over the past 20 years. In statistics from the Illinois Board of Higher Education (IBHE), SIUE has demonstrated a 26.8 percent growth in total enrollment from 1996-2016.

The Southern Illinois University Edwardsville Alumni Association has selected Jack Glassman, PhD, as its 2017 Great Teacher Award recipient. The New York City native is a physics professor in the SIUE College of Arts and Sciences (CAS). Glassman is the 47th SIUE faculty member to receive the honor since its inception in 1970.
